Title: Mohan John: Innovator in Vehicle Technology
Introduction
Mohan John is a prominent inventor based in Dearborn, MI (US), known for his contributions to vehicle technology. He holds a total of 8 patents, showcasing his innovative approach to enhancing vehicle performance and comfort.
Latest Patents
One of his latest patents is focused on the automatic control of heating and cooling of a vehicle seating assembly. This invention utilizes predictive modeling to recalibrate based on occupant manual control. The method involves presenting a vehicle with a seating assembly that includes a temperature-altering element. A controller communicates with this element and employs a Pre-established Predictive Activation Model that governs its activation based on identifiable conditions. The system collects data while an occupant is seated and determines whether to activate the temperature-altering element based on the collected data.
Another significant patent by Mohan John is a method and system for vehicle stop/start control. This innovation aims to improve the performance of a vehicle operating in cruise control mode. The controller adjusts torque output to maintain vehicle speed within a desired range, utilizing a vehicle dynamics model and a fuel consumption map to inform a nonlinear model predictive controller.
